The Title Question, Answered Clearly

If the asset already exists in a form that is visually close, technically usable, and properly licensed, searching stock libraries is usually faster. If the project needs a distinct object, a stylized look, a branded concept, or a shape that keeps failing in search results, generating one custom 3D asset is usually the better route.

That is why this is not really a “buy versus build” question in the abstract. It is a specificity question. The more specific the brief becomes, the more likely it is that stock search turns into a long sequence of near misses. At that point, custom generation stops being a creative luxury and becomes a practical production choice.

Why Stock Libraries Stop Working

Stock libraries work best when the model category is common and the project can tolerate someone else’s design choices. That is often true for:

  • basic furniture
  • ordinary environment props
  • standard containers, tools, or architecture pieces
  • background assets with low uniqueness requirements

But stock libraries become inefficient when the team keeps rejecting candidates for the same reasons. Common failure patterns include:

  • the silhouette is too generic
  • the style does not match the project
  • the material zones are baked together
  • the proportions feel wrong
  • the model is hard to edit
  • the package does not support the target workflow

When those failures repeat, the team is no longer “one search away” from success. It is spending time scanning catalogs that are not built for the brief.

When One Custom 3D Asset Is the Better Decision

Generating one custom 3D asset makes more sense when the project needs more control than a stock library can realistically provide. This often happens in four scenarios.

1. The Asset Needs a Distinct Identity

Some assets are not just functional objects. They carry style, worldbuilding, or brand meaning. A fantasy vending machine, a signature sci-fi terminal, a mascot-like robot, or a stylized product display object may need to look recognizable at first glance. In those cases, “close enough” often fails the art direction.

2. The Team Has a Strong Visual Reference

If the team already has a sketch, concept sheet, moodboard, or image reference, custom generation can aim at that source material directly. This is more aligned with V2Fun’s workflow because the asset can begin from text, a single image, or multi-view references instead of relying on category browsing.

3. Variants Need to Stay Consistent

A project may need three or five related props, or several versions of the same object in different colors, materials, or sizes. Stock libraries may offer one strong candidate, but not a controlled family of matching assets. Custom generation is often better when consistency across variants matters as much as the first model itself.

4. The Asset Will Be Reused Later

If the object is likely to return in updates, client revisions, marketing scenes, or future game content, having a custom asset can be more valuable than adapting a purchased model that was never designed for that reuse path.

A Practical V2Fun Workflow for Creating One Custom Asset

The best custom-asset workflow starts with a brief that is specific enough to reject weak outputs.

Step 1: Define the Asset Before Generation

Write down the parts that really matter:

  • what the object is for
  • what it should look like
  • which materials should read separately
  • what style it belongs to
  • where it will be used next
  • whether it needs editing after export

This step matters because vague prompts create vague comparisons. If the team cannot explain what makes an output wrong, it cannot reliably improve the next round.

Step 2: Choose the Right Input Route

V2Fun supports more than one starting point, so the right route depends on what the team already has.

  • Use text input when the idea is early and still needs exploration.
  • Use image input when the visual direction is already clear.
  • Use multi-view input when the team needs stronger control over shape and structure.

This is one reason V2Fun is useful for custom asset creation: the workflow can start from the form of brief the team already owns, instead of forcing every project into the same input method.

Step 3: Review the Asset as a Working Candidate

The first successful output is not the finish line. Review:

  • silhouette
  • proportions
  • recognizable features
  • material separation
  • surface readability
  • editability after export

The goal is not to ask whether the preview looks impressive. The goal is to ask whether this asset is moving toward the actual brief.

Step 4: Continue Into Texturing and Export

For many teams, the custom asset becomes useful only after the look starts to stabilize. V2Fun’s texturing workflow matters here because it helps carry the asset beyond raw shape generation. Once the result is textured and exported, the team can validate it in the destination tool, engine, or content pipeline.

Step 5: Validate the First Real Handoff

A custom asset is only valuable if it survives the next environment. After export, check:

  • scale
  • geometry cleanliness
  • texture package completeness
  • material reconstruction
  • editability
  • destination compatibility

If the project is character-based, the validation should also include rigging readiness, deformation checks, and animation behavior where relevant.

When Stock Libraries Still Win

Custom generation is not automatically the better route. Stock libraries still have a clear advantage when:

  • the object is common
  • uniqueness is not important
  • the team needs a usable placeholder immediately
  • a licensed model already matches the brief closely
  • the project has limited cleanup capacity

In those cases, searching first can still be the right call. The point is not to replace stock libraries in every workflow. The point is to recognize when stock is creating drag instead of saving time.
